Uta 08/07/23 7:43:56 PM #308: | They really did Warlock dirty I feel. In 5E warlock has the dishonorable reputation of basically having all its best features at level 2, making it a really efficient splash but not something you'd actually play. Instead of addressing these problems they arbitrarily nerf one of the Pacts, tweak another without actually fixing its core problems, and otherwise do nothing at all.
Hexblade Curse (Bonus Action, 1 Target. Recharges on Short Rest)
Pact of the Chain didn't really get nerfed too bad. It gets extra attack at 5 too but familiars aren't known for their attack power. Still, it manages to further outperform swordlock so...lol, and Pact of Tomes got nerfed the hardest. Goodbye unique niche as a super flexible ritual caster, you get...cantrips. And later, 1/long rest spells probably better covered by your other party members. Why? The ability to record spells into a book is already a thing, as are Ritual Spells.
